     Nintendo Switch specifications
    After Nvidia's last showing with the RSX chip on the PS3, the Nintendo Switch will be sporting a custom Tegra processor, another leak that has come true. According to Nvidia, it's a "high-efficiency scalable processor includes an Nvidia GPU based on the same architecture as the world’s top-performing GeForce gaming graphics cards." The idea is, according to the company, to allow blistering fast to the mainstream, building NVN - a new API to make this possible, along with a new physics engine, advanced game tools, and libraries to boot. Though nothing has been said of its raw performance numbers, its developer kits allegedly sport the following specifications:
    Four ARM Cortex-A57 cores, max 2GHz Nvidia second-generation Maxwell architecture 256 CUDA cores, max 1GHz, 1024 FLOPS/cycle 4GB RAM (25.6 GB/s, VRAM shared) 32 GB storage (Max transfer 400 MB/s) USB 2.0 and  3.0 1280 x 720 6.2-inch IPS LCD 1080p at 60 fps or 4k at 30 fps max video output Capcitance method, 10-point multi-touch
